In the latest episode of Into the Badlands Sunny runs into an old foe. Meanwhile, Tilda has new problems with Odessa and a new agreement with The Widow. We also had a major death.

The episode of Into the Badlands begins with Sunny and Bajie arriving at a colorful market. We immediately see that this place is not for regular citizens. There are dog fights, people fighting in the streets, and exotic animals being sold.

We are introduced to a lady who is playing a game of chance that could end in your hand being impaled. When the person playing against her accuses her of cheating another fight is about to break out when Bajie steps in to defend her. Her name is Lily and she is the person Bajie is there to find. When the fight breaks out, Bajie seems to be doing fine but he looks over to Sunny confused because he’s not helping.

Sunny was angry when Bajie jumped into the fight and instead is having a drink. Between fighting, Bajie keeps looking over at Sunny who is completely unmoved. However, when a few guys turn their attention to Lily, Sunny finishes his drink and jumps in. He is fighting with Henry strapped to his back and dodging when people go to hit him in the back.

They eventually escape but Lily is not happy. She tells them that she won’t be welcomed back into The Black Wind now. This is when Bajie tells Sunny that she is his ex-wife.

Tilda and Odessa

Back in the Badlands, Odessa calls Lydia out for leaving the refugee camp. Lydia tells them that when the war is over the poppy fields will grow food and people will reap what they sow. She also tells Odessa and Tilda that they are fighting a war they can’t possibly win and that they need to choose to either work with The Widow or die.

When she leaves the room Odessa says she’s done fighting and wants out. Tilda tells Odessa that she won’t turn her back on the refugees. When Odessa asks if that means she would rather turn her back on her, Tilda doesn’t say anything. Odessa tells Tilda to rest and leaves.

Pilgrim learns about Castor

At the site where Pilgrim is building, he delivers a great speech to the refugees that have been delivered to him. He tells them they aren’t prisoners and offers them to become Acolytes. They all join and pick up pick axes to get to work.

Chau’s regent then comes over to confirm that her debt is paid. Pilgrim confirms that it is and the regent offers his condolences for Castor. He tells Pilgrim he fought well but was captured.

Back at the temple (museum), Pilgrim confronts Cressida about this. When she says that he chose to go and that their duty is to Azra not to the kid, Pilgrim gets even more angry. He takes an incredibly strong tone (which we haven’t seen from him up to this point) and tells her that if she deceives him again she will suffer.

Sunny remembers the boat

Back on the boat, Sunny is talking with Bajie when he has a sudden memory. He remembers being on this boat as a child and tells Bajie he’s been remembering things ever since Ankara touched him. He feels like he’s losing his mind.

Sunny then goes to Lily and asks how she’s getting past the River King. She tells Sunny that she has an arrangement with him, which should have alarmed him. She goes on to tell him about how she and Bajie hooked up as pirates and that one day he got a lead on Azra and left. He took all of the money they had and left her a note. She’s been struggling ever since.

Tilda and the Widow

Tilda goes back and sees the devastation at the refugee camp. She tells the nurse, Vitania, that she wants to help but Vitania tells her that they need protection. She fears Baron Chau’s clippers will return.

Tilda then meets with Minerva. She tells her that she wants to help take Chau down but not as her regent or as her daughter. The Widow is surprised but can see that Tilda is working to hide any emotion as she agrees to the truce.

Captive Castor

Minerva then goes to where she’s holding Castor. It’s the same room MK was previously in and she asks Castor how Pilgrim controls his gift. Castor says that Pilgrim was chosen by Azra which obviously doesn’t satisfy The Widow.

After Castor falls back unconscious, Moon suggests that they cut his head off and send it to Pilgrim to send a message. Minerva instead insists that he be prepped for travel. She doesn’t want to intimidate Pilgrim, she wants answers from him.

Sunny has another vision

Sunny is sleeping when he jumps awake. He sees his younger self again and this time he follows him through the boat to another area. There is a symbol carved into the bedpost and Sunny suddenly remembers carving it. As the full memory comes back, we can hear chaos on the upper deck before a hand comes over young Sunny’s mouth to keep him quiet.

The Widow and Pilgrim

A rendezvous was set up for PIlgrim and Minerva and at the meeting they argue about him taking the refugees. She warns him to stay out of her war and he asks her about Castor.

When she has Castor brought out he is confused and asks her why she’d be kind to him in this way. She replies that a father should get to say goodbye to their son and that they aren’t enemies. Pilgrim then says that anyone who seeks power for themselves and will not humble themselves before him is his enemy.

Minerva then steps to him and says she seeks peace for the Badlands and she won’t humble herself before him or any other man.

The small exchanges

  • As Castor is being handed off, MK makes eye contact with Tilda. She’s concerned but he seems happy as an Acolyte.
  • Before they part, Cressida tells Minerva that she had the gift. Minerva is shocked that she knew this. When Cressida asks if she longs to have it back, The Widow walks away.
  • Moon is shocked by Minerva’s play but she says that she bought them time with Pilgrim. She says she’s going to need to take down Chau first because she’ll need her army to fight the Acolytes.

The River King

Sunny wakes up again, this time there is really shouting outside. As he emerges, he sees Bajie being held with a long blade to his neck. Additional men show up to confront Sunny. Lily has turned them in to The River King because they had a large bounty on their heads.

A fight ensues and Lily escapes to her cabin where she can watch the fight.

Though they took some blows, Sunny and Bajie manage to fight off enough of the men to get the upper hand for a second. When Bajie confronts Lily she puts a blade to his neck. He apologies, genuinely, for what he did to her and she lowers the blade.

The River King re-emerges (he had ducked out when the fighting began) thinking that his men have got Sunny cornered. Sunny then appears above him and attacks. He has The River King pinned as a man tries to come up behind him but Lily takes him out.

Sunny asks him why he shouldn’t gut him and The River King says that he can help get him to Pilgrim. Sunny decides to take him prisoner instead of killing him.

Castor’s fate

Back at the temple (museum), Nix is nursing Castor who is weaker than ever. He tells her that Pilgrim lied by telling them they’d see Azra together as he won’t live to see it. He tries to shake her faith but she isn’t wavering. When MK comes in Castor tries to attack him. MK doesn’t want to fight but when he’s given no choice he starts to. Nix breaks it up before any real fighting takes place.

At that point Pilgrim shows up and tells Nix to leave with MK. To add insult to illness, Nix grabs MK by the hand as they leave. Castor is clearly hurt by this. He apologizes to Pilgrim for how he acted.

They are in a part of the museum that was dedicated to the samurai and Pilgrim gives Castor a history lesson. He concludes his samurai lesson by saying that the sharpness of their blades was only matched by the purity of their hearts and that he too is pure. He then tells Castor that they’ll sing his praises in the halls of Azra as her grabs him and snaps his neck.

The episode ends with him crying and holding Castor’s body.

Conclusion

After fighting with Cressida all season about not putting Castor out of his misery Pilgrim finally decided to. This had to be a tough decision for him and it’s going to be interesting to see how this affects him going forward. Meanwhile, Cressida knows that she’s on his bad side so there are some cracks in the Acolyte foundation.

The next episode did not hint to us about what happens with the Acolytes but it looks like Wren may be back to challenge The Widow with a new leg. Sunny also runs into someone who recognizes him as the boy the men were after when the boat was attacked when he was a child. It looks to be a big episode
